PTE to IELTS Score is evaluated on different scales and criteria. IELTS band score ranges from 0 to 9 and PTE uses a scale from 10 to 90, with 10-point increments. The writing and speaking section of IELTS is evaluated by human, and the listening and reading section is scored by computer. PTE Academic is completely scored by advanced algorithms. To convert PTE to IELTS scores candidates must check all the 4 sections score and make an average score. For example in IELTS to PTE conversion: PTE Academic score of 58.5, with each section scores in sub-skills as listening - 56.8, reading - 60.6, writing - 74.1, speaking - 53.5, when converted to IELTS score it will be 6.5 overall.

alt tags

PTE uses an automated scoring system to evaluate your test results, whereas IELTS result is evaluated manually. You can receive the PTE results within 2 days whereas for IELTS, it might require up to 2 weeks for the results. If you want to take a test which is totally based on computers, PTE is the one for you. If you want a paper based format and more traditional approach, you must go for the IELTS exam.

PTE and IELTS both the exam helps to access the English speaking, reading, writing and listening skills of a candidate who wants to study abroad. The time allotted for IELTS exam is 2 hours and 45 minutes, while PTE is conducted a 2 hours and 20 minutes exam. PTE charges INR 17,000 for the exam, and IELTS registration fee is INR 16,250. PTE Score to IELTS Band

A 6.5 band in PTE is fall within the range of 59 to 73. IELTS scores and PTE are two different methods for assessing candidates' English language skills. IELTS is complicated than PTE as reviewed by test-takers. Some find PTE more challenging due to its integrated format and reliance on computer skills, while others may prefer IELTS, which assesses skills separately. Here is compare IELTS and PTE score for candidates to understand the scoring better:

PTE Score Range IELTS Band Score
86 & above 9
83-85 8.5
79-82 8
73-78 7.5
65-72 7
59-64 6.5
51-58 6
43-50 5.5
35-42 5
30-34 4.5

Concordance Table between IELTS and PTE Section wise

The concordance table is a comparison between individual sectional scores of PTE with IELTS. Pearson will issue the most recent PTE and IELTS Concordance Report on December 1st, 2021. In 2011, the report updated the new PTE and IELTS exam score conversion chart from the old one. The degree of English competence evolves throughout time. As a result, the PTE team assesses how PTE band scores compare to other exams on a regular basis. PTE applicants should stay up to date on scoring system changes in order to quickly adapt their study schedules. PTE score chart with IELTS helps candidates to understand the individual section scores.

It should be noted that candidates may find one test easier than the other, although the PTE and IELTS score chart simplifies conversion.

IELTS Band Score PTE-A (overall) PTE-A (listening) PTE-A (reading) PTE-A (writing) PTE-A (speaking)
8.5 88.1 84.7 83.7 89.5 85.5
8 82.3 79.4 78.4 89.4 80.9
7.5 74.6 73.9 73.7 87.5 75.3
7 66.3 66.2 67.6 82.3 65.3
6.5 58.5 56.8 60.6 74.1 53.5
6 51.6 48.1 53.5 62.2 46.2
5.5 45.4 42.7 47.9 51 42.2
5 40.8 40.2 43 43.1 40.2

PTE Score in Bands

Pearson just issued a new analysis comparing PTE-A results to leading IELTS Band scores. It specifies that PTE-A exam takers will require a better score to be equivalent to IELTS for an IELTS band 7 to 9. Though the Australian and New Zealand immigration offices have not yet implemented this concordance report, it is important to remember the new score requirements based on the PTE score calculator with IELTS when preparing for the PTE Academic test. Here are details about PTE Scoring tabulated below:

IELTS Bands PTE Scores PTE Scores (Proposed)
9 86-90 N/A
8.5 83-85 89
8 79-82 84-88
7.5 73-78 76-83
7.0 65-72 66-75
6.5 58-64 56-65
6.0 50-57 46-55
5.5 42-49 36-45
5.0 36-41 29-35
4.5 29-35 23-28

Ques - Is PTE accepted in USA?

Ans - Yes, PTE score is accepted in USA and other countries like UK, Canada, Australa. PTE exam scores are accepted by most of the top universities in USA. There are 3,300+ institutions worldwide, including Oxford University, Harvard Business School, and Yale that accepts PTE. 

Ques - Does Australia prefer PTE or IELTS?

Ans - According to most of the candidates studying or working, IELTS exam is best for Australia. However., many students are now PTE as more and more universities has started accepting PTE scores. 

Ques - How many years is PTE score valid?

Ans - PTE exam score is valid up to two years from the date of the examination. You can send the scores to as many universities you like within 2 years. Once the test scores are expired, you must retake the test. 

Ques - What is the maximum PTE marks?

Ans - The maximum PTE score or the PTE exam full score is 90. The lowest score is 10 and is calculated on a 10 points increment.
